Word: Tafia
Speech Type: Noun
Etymology:
via French from West Indian creole, alteration of ratafia
Audio Pronunciation:
Phonetic Spelling:
ˈtafɪə
Dialects: British English
Definition:
a drink similar to rum, distilled from molasses or waste from the production of brown sugar.
